After years of DYI, design on the cheap, mini make-overs, "design" being done in a day etc. I thought it would be nice to see what good design is all about. <br /><br />Albeit the show is tremendously entertaining most designers I know, even very famous ones with whom I have had the pleasure of having conversations about business, do not spend their clients's money without any considerations for cost. For example, I have used antique French terra cotta tiles similar to the ones Nathan Turner installed on that veranda, and the floor did not end up being 50K. Nor do I think a decorative box without provenance or absolutely exquisite materials & workmanship is a deal at $ 2,500.00. I tend to question pricing, and want to make sure that everything we buy on a client's behalf is a good value. Essentially we don't only manage their design but also their money, and we need to do it wisely.<br /><br />But then again, I do agree with Laura, if they want it done in three days and look smashing they cannot consider budget.<br /><br />I do look forward the the rest of season, as you do get some insight into high-end design, and all the designers have captivating personalities.
